منذ التحديث الأخير، ظهرت هذه الرسالة التحذيرية

مرحباً بالجميع،

لقد قمت بالتحديث وأنا الآن على الإصدار 2026.3.0-latest.1 ومنذ ذلك الحين لدي تحذير

[ملاحظة المسؤول] الملحق “discourse-category-custom-fields” يحتوي على رمز يحتاج إلى تحديث. (المعرف: discourse.resolver-resolutions)

أنا أستخدم إصدار دوكر، إذا فهمت بشكل صحيح يتم استبدال hbs بـ .gjs ولكنني لا أعرف كيف أتصرف ولكني أريد التأكد من أن هذه هي المشكلة بالفعل.

شكراً لكم

هذا لا يتعلق بـ hbs. إنه متعلق بـ resolver-resolutions:

يمكنك دائمًا العثور على مزيد من المعلومات حول المشكلة في وحدة تحكم المتصفح.
المشكلة تكمن في المكون الإضافي discourse-category-custom-fields، لذا ستحتاج إلى الإبلاغ عن المشكلة إلى المؤلف. إنه أمر غريب بعض الشيء، لأن هذا المكون الإضافي يبدو كعرض توضيحي للاختبار، بدلاً من كونه مكونًا إضافيًا حقيقيًا. هل أنت متأكد من أنك بحاجة إليه في موقعك؟ إذا لم يكن الأمر كذلك، فإن إلغاء تثبيته سيحل مشكلة لافتة التحذير.

شكراً لردك، سأرى ما إذا كنت أحتاج إليه حقًا

هل هناك شيء جديد؟ لدي نفس التحذير ولا أعرف ما يجب فعله.

يجب عليك الانتقال إلى لوحة الإدارة ثم إلى الإضافات المثبتة. بعد ذلك، ابحث عن discourse-category-custom-fields، قم بإيقاف تشغيله، ثم قم بتحديث الصفحة. يجب أن تعمل الأمور بشكل صحيح بعد ذلك.

ربما يساعد ذلك في الإبلاغ عن هذه المسألة في موضوع هذا الإضافة. وعلى الرغم من أن الأمر أشبه بمثال، إلا أن تحديثه قد يكون مفيدًا.

آه… أنا مش مرتب قليلاً

رسالة الخطأ الكاملة هي:

[تنبيه من المشرف] تحتوي الإضافة “discourse-landing-pages” على كود يحتاج إلى تحديث. (المعرف: discourse.resolver-resolutions)

لا أملك إضافة discourse-category-custom-fields

لكن لدي إضافة Landing pages. هل هذه هي التي يجب عليّ تعطيلها؟

نعم، وإذا قمت بتحديث الصفحة (F5) يجب أن يختفي رسالتك.

إذا كنت بحاجة إلى الإضافة، فستحتاج إلى إبلاغ المؤلف لتصحيحها إن أمكن.

شكرًا لك، لكن لا يمكن تعطيلها (يمكن فقط حذفها).

ولا أعرف وظيفة هذه الإضافة.

لقد أرسلت بريدًا إلكترونيًا إلى المؤلف (كان هناك خطأ في البريد). وقد فتحت مسألة على GitHub.

هناك بالفعل تقرير حول هذا الموضوع في المنتدى، لكن لم يتم الرد عليه حتى الآن.

بديلاً، يمكنك تعديل ملف app.yml. يجب أن يكون لديك أمر git clone « GitHub - paviliondev/discourse-landing-pages: Adds landing pages to Discourse · GitHub »؛ ضع علامة # أمام السطر ثم احفظ الملف.

بعد ذلك، قم بإعادة البناء عن طريق كتابة ./launcher rebuild app